1 Nephi Chapter 4

Verse 1

Nephi tells his brothers they need to try again. He knows the power the Lord has and that he has greater power then Laban. Nephi, who has tried twice before to get the plates and has been yelled at and beaten by his brothers, still gets up and encourages them to try again. What perseverance! I give up too easily sometimes and it’s not a good thing. When things get too hard or when I feel like I am not good enough I give up. I need to be more like Nephi.

Verse 2

Nephi uses the example of Moses parting the Red Sea to show the power the Lord has and how his desires are always accomplished. I love how he refers to the scriptures and to those good examples who have gone before. I want to be able to pull example from the scriptures more.

Verse 3

Nephi encourages his brothers with love and with evidences that they have received that they can accomplish this task. I love how positive he is. I know that I am negative too much of the time and it is a weakness I have. But the Lord shows us our weakness that we can make them strengths. I need to strive to be more positive.

Verse 4

Even after the encouragement and testimony of Nephi and the visit from the angel, Laman and Lemuel still murmured and were still angry. They went with Nephi but begrudgingly. I am like Laman and Lemuel too much I think! Reading the scriptures is an eye opener!
